hi doctor my daughter got an implant in her arm to prevet a pregnancy,but now shes been telling me she feel movement, she says when she eats theres something moveing in her stomache and when shes trying to sleep at night she feels kicking,and movements and it hurts her when its moveing and she has breast milk doctor what should I do we had a pregnancy test it came back negative .
Hello and Welcome to ‘Ask A Doctor’ service. I have reviewed your query and here is my advice.
Implants does not cause kicking movements in the abdomen. It may be due to excessive anxiety arising due to the fear of getting pregnant. Nothing much to worry has implants good efficacy and she will not get pregnant. If she is not comfortable she can add a backup contraceptives like condoms for a while.
